I know there are currently some bugs in how prepend is working. Try adding prepend to the first isNotNull section also. For some reason it seems you have to prepend="and" to places where you wouldn't think it would be needed. Michael Schall wrote: > I have the following code and does not work. Is this a bug or am I > not understanding how the prepend should work? I get a "sql error > near tp_Calls". The prepends aren't adding in the "and" to the > resultant sql string. > > <dynamic prepend="WHERE"> > <![CDATA[ > OffHookDt <= #EndDate# AND > OffHookDt >= #StartDate# > ]]> > <isNotNull property="LocationCode"> > <isNotEqual prepend="and" property="LocationCode" compareValue="%"> > tp_Calls.LocationCd = #LocationCode# > </isNotEqual> > </isNotNull> > <isNotEqual prepend="and" property="RateType" compareValue="-1"> > RateType = #RateType# > </isNotEqual> > <isEqual prepend="and" property="PrivateAllowed" compareValue="0"> > tp_Calls.Hidden = 0 > </isEqual> > </dynamic> > > If I change it to the following everything works great. > > <dynamic prepend="WHERE"> > <![CDATA[ > OffHookDt <= #EndDate# AND > OffHookDt >= #StartDate# > ]]> > <isNotNull property="LocationCode"> > <isNotEqual property="LocationCode" compareValue="%"> > and tp_Calls.LocationCd = #LocationCode# > </isNotEqual> > </isNotNull> > <isNotEqual property="RateType" compareValue="-1"> > and RateType = #RateType# > </isNotEqual> > <isEqual property="PrivateAllowed" compareValue="0"> > and tp_Calls.Hidden = 0 > </isEqual> > </dynamic> > > Mike >
